### 内容主体大纲1. **引言** - 数字货币的兴起与普及 - 手机在数字货币交易中的重要性2. **数字货币与手机的关系** ...
随着区块链技术的快速发展,以太坊作为一个开源的区块链平台,吸引了大量开发者和企业进行代币创建和智能合约开发。在这篇文章中,我们将详细探讨如何在以太坊钱包中的开发代币。
代币不仅在数字货币的交流中发挥着重要作用,更在众多应用中展现可授予不同权利或功能的潜力。随着DeFi(去中心化金融)和NFT(非同质化代币)的兴起,代币的价值和重要性愈发明显。
#### 2. 以太坊及其生态系统以太坊是一个分布式的智能合约平台,允许开发者创建去中心化的应用。其核心特性在于智能合约的使用,这为代币开发奠定了基础。以太坊钱包则是用户存储、发送和接收以太坊及其相关代币的工具。
在选择以太坊钱包开发代币时,了解钱包的基本功能是至关重要的。其中包括资金安全、用户私钥管理以及与区块链的交互能力等。
#### 3. 代币的类型与选择以太坊上有多种类型的代币,最常见的两种是ERC-20和ERC-721。ERC-20代币是一种可互换的代币,这类代币广泛应用于金融服务和去中心化应用。而ERC-721则是非同质化代币,通常用于数字艺术品和收藏品。
本篇指南将以ERC-20代币为主要焦点,分析其优势和使用场景,帮助读者更好地理解如何进行代币开发。
#### 4. 开发代币的前期准备在开始代币开发之前,了解必备的工具和环境非常重要。你需要选择合适的开发框架,如Truffle或Hardhat,这些框架简化了智能合约的部署流程。同样,还要有Node.js和Ganache等软件开发工具,以搭建合适的开发环境。
同时,编写智能合约所需的基础知识包括Solidity语言,这是以太坊智能合约的主要编程语言。
#### 5. 创建ERC-20代币的步骤创建ERC-20代币的步骤包括编写智能合约、部署和测试。编写智能合约时,需要按照ERC-20标准实现一系列规定的函数,例如总供应量、转账和允许的功能等。
成功编写智能合约后,使用Truffle等工具进行部署,最终通过测试网络验证代币功能的有效性。
#### 6. 将代币添加到以太坊钱包一旦代币成功创建,下一步便是将代币添加到用户的以太坊钱包。用户需要获取代币的合约地址,并在钱包中进行相应设置,以确保代币能够正确显示。
此外,用户还需确认代币是否能够正常交易,确保所有的功能都按照预期工作。
#### 7. 代币的后续管理与维护在线上后,代币的管理和维护也是一个重要的环节,包括实时监测代币的表现和用户反馈。安全性和合规性是维护代币的重要方面,要确保合约没有漏洞,并符合相关法律法规。
#### 8. 常见问题解答 ##### 如何处理代币智能合约的漏洞?在建立代币的过程中,智能合约的安全性至关重要。要处理代币智能合约的漏洞,可以采取以下几种方法:
- 通过编写测试用例覆盖合约中所有的功能和逻辑,进行充分的单元测试。
- 使用自动化工具来扫描和分析合约安全性,例如MythX和Slither等工具。
- 定期进行合约审计,寻找潜在的安全隐患。
- 向社区报告,并开发者共同协作,提升合约的安全性。
##### 代币的合法性如何确保?代币的合法性与合规性直接关系到代币的使用和推广。确保代币的合法性可以通过以下方式进行:
- 在设计代币时,遵循当地的法律和法规,特别是对证券法的相关条款进行深入了解。
- 寻求律师意见,以确保代币的发行和交易不会违反现有法律。
- 尽量进行合规性制定,了解KYC(了解你的客户)和AML(反洗钱)政策,并在代币发行过程中遵循这些政策。
##### 如何处理代币市场价格波动?代币市场的价格波动是不可避免的,开发者和持有者应制定相应的策略来应对:
- 采用价值基础模式,例如通过引入回购机制来稳定代币的价格。
- 关注市场情绪变化并及时调整项目的宣传和推广策略。
- 声明代币的使用场景和稳定性,让用户对代币有信心。
##### 如何扩展代币的功能?在代币开发完成后,可以考虑扩展代币的功能,例如增加治理模型、引入质押机制等:
- 通过创建新的智能合约,加入新的功能模块,使代币在生态系统中提供更多服务。
- 考虑持有者的反馈,定期更新和升级代币合约,提升用户体验。
##### 如何推广和营销新开发的代币?代币的推广和营销至关重要,可以采取以下措施:
- 利用社交媒体和加密货币社区进行营销,吸引潜在用户和投资者。
- 通过Telegram、Discord等平台创建社区讨论,提高用户的参与感。
- 举办AMA(Ask Me Anything)等形式的活动,提高项目的曝光度和可信度。
##### 代币的未来发展趋势?代币的发展趋势包括:
- 伴随着DeFi和NFT市场的蓬勃发展,代币的多样化和应用场景将更加丰富。
- 合规性趋严的背景下,合规代币的发展将成为市场的重要组成部分。
- 区块链技术的进步将促使代币经济模型的创新,推动代币在不同领域的应用。
#### 9. 结语在以太坊钱包中开发代币是一个复杂但充满潜力的过程,从初始的准备到后期的推广,每一步都需细致谨慎。希望本文能够为有志于进入代币开发领域的开发者和企业提供清晰的指引。随着技术的发展,未来的代币开发将会迎来更多新的机遇和挑战。
--- 这段内容仅为示例,实际内容应根据具体情况进行扩展,以满足3700字的要求。